description Mary Schweitzer Overview

Mary Higby Schweitzer is an American paleontologist and a professor at North Carolina State University, recognized for her work in the field of molecular paleontology. She is best known for her 2005 reports detailing the discovery of pliable soft tissues and proteins, including blood vessel-like structures, within a Tyrannosaurus rex femur fossil. Her research focuses on taphonomy and the microscopic analysis of fossilized remains to understand organic preservation. These findings have significantly influenced scientific study regarding the degradation and potential recovery of ancient biomolecules.

help Mary Schweitzer FAQ

What university is paleontologist Mary Schweitzer affiliated with?

Mary Higby Schweitzer is a professor at North Carolina State University. She conducts her research there as a leading figure in the specialized field of molecular paleontology.

What major discovery made Mary Schweitzer famous in 2005?

In 2005, she published groundbreaking reports detailing the discovery of pliable soft tissues and proteins inside dinosaur bones. This finding revolutionized the study of molecular paleontology.

What specific field of paleontology does Mary Schweitzer specialize in?

Schweitzer is widely recognized for her pioneering work in the field of molecular paleontology. This discipline focuses on detecting original organic molecules, like proteins, in ancient fossils.

What type of biological material was Mary Schweitzer able to find in fossils?

Schweitzer famously reported finding pliable soft tissues and proteins, including blood vessel-like structures, in fossilized remains. These findings challenged previous assumptions that organic matter could not survive over millions of years.
